What is a WTCAMP file?

A WTCAMP file is a campaign file used by Wee Tanks!, a 3D action game developed by Studio Kit. It contains a collection of levels, objectives, and other gameplay data that define a specific campaign or scenario within the game. WTCAMP files allow players to create and share custom campaigns, offering a wide variety of gameplay experiences beyond the base game.

Opening WTCAMP Files

WTCAMP files, associated with the game Wee Tanks!, are campaign files that contain information about the game’s levels, objectives, and other campaign-related data. To open a WTCAMP file, you will need the Wee Tanks! game installed on your computer. Once the game is installed, you can open WTCAMP files by double-clicking on them. The files will automatically open in the Wee Tanks! game, where you can access the campaign information.
